The Room
When he looked up from the computer screen
he saw things he had never seen.
The door was closed.
The books on the shelves
stood like sentinels
guarding the mysteries within
and beyond.
The television screen was blank
only waiting for a pulse of electrons
to spring to life
and create moving objects
that carried words through the ether
to waiting eyes
perched on sofas and chairs
expectantly desiring news that would inspire
and bring hope.
The clutter was comforting,
and created opportunities for action
that he had ignored in the past.
Would a tangle of cables
and old technology
create work that would distract,
or would it frighten him
into catatonic slumber?
He decided to open the door,
and to venture into the light of day,
carefully covering his body
with protective gear
and carrying magic
in his hands
to keep the demons away.
